I was waiting for locals to respond to your inquiry on BNSF channels in the Seattle-Everett area, but if you need a quick answer, these are the channels I use on trips to Seattle: BNSF Railroad Scenic and Seattle Subdivisions 161.100 DS-82 Seattle East Disp. Olds Jct.(Wenatchee)- MP8(Ballard) 161.160 DS-74 Seattle Terminal Disp. MP8-Tukwila 161.920 DS-75 Centralia North Disp. Tukwila-Nisqually 161.100 DS-86 Centralia South Disp. Nisqually-Vancouver Jct North 161.250 DS-31 Vancouver Term. Disp. Vancouver Jct N - Vancouver 161.250 DS-34 Vancouver Term. Disp. Vancouver-Portland OR Hope this is some help.
